ESFJ Consul

ESFJ

Consul · The Provider

ESFJs are driven by dominant Fe (Extraverted Feeling), naturally attuned to the emotional needs and social dynamics around them. Their auxiliary Si (Introverted Sensing) provides a strong sense of tradition, loyalty, and practical care. Warm and conscientious, they create harmony in their communities through active nurturing and reliable support, finding genuine fulfillment in helping others feel valued and cared for.

ESTP Entrepreneur

ESTP

Entrepreneur · The Doer

ESTPs are driven by dominant Se (Extraverted Sensing), giving them exceptional awareness of their immediate environment and the ability to act decisively in the moment. Their auxiliary Ti (Introverted Thinking) provides analytical precision, making them natural problem-solvers who think on their feet. Energetic and pragmatic, they thrive on action and tangible results, approaching life with bold confidence and adaptability.

ESFJ

Strengths

  • Exceptional ability to understand and meet others' emotional needs
  • Strong organizational skills and practical follow-through
  • Natural talent for creating warm, welcoming environments
  • Reliable and consistent in commitments and relationships
  • Skilled at building and maintaining social connections
ESTP

Strengths

  • Exceptional situational awareness and quick reflexes
  • Pragmatic problem-solving under pressure
  • Natural ability to read people and situations
  • Adaptable and resourceful in any environment
  • Direct, confident communication style
ESFJ

Growth Areas

  • May prioritize others' needs to the point of self-neglect
  • Can be sensitive to criticism and social disapproval
  • Tendency toward inflexibility when traditions are challenged
  • May struggle with impersonal logical analysis (Ti inferior)
  • Can become anxious when social harmony is disrupted
ESTP

Growth Areas

  • Difficulty with long-term planning and abstract thinking
  • May overlook emotional nuances in favor of action
  • Tendency toward impulsive decisions without considering consequences
  • Can become bored with routine and sustained focus
  • May dismiss theoretical or philosophical discussions as impractical

Frequently Asked Questions

What is the main difference between ESFJ and ESTP?
ESFJ (Consul) and ESTP (Entrepreneur) differ on 2 of the four personality dimensions. ESFJ leans toward Feeling (F), Judging (J), while ESTP prefers Thinking (T), Perceiving (P). These differences shape how each type takes in information, makes decisions, and organizes daily life.
What do ESFJ and ESTP have in common?
ESFJ and ESTP share 2 of the four preferences: Extroversion (E), Sensing (S). They tend to connect naturally over these shared tendencies even as their differences add balance to the relationship.
Are ESFJ and ESTP compatible?
ESFJ and ESTP are not listed as each other's top matches, but compatibility is never determined by type alone. Shared values, respect, and communication matter far more than the four-letter code.
